Geometric tattoos are increasingly trendy for individuals desiring art that merges simplicity and complexity. As someone who appreciates clean lines and bold shapes, I found the appeal of geometric designs undeniable. Such designs often are made up of intricate patterns, like three-sided shapes, circles, and multi-sided figures, producing mesmerizing patterns on the skin. The exactness in each line produces a symmetrical, coordinated look that stands out in its refined aesthetic.
